What to Bring:

  • Your UCR Student Identification Number (SID#).  This is a 9-digit number and can be found on MyUCR
  • Photo identification
  • Advanced Placement test scores (when available). Send these and any other placement exam scores in to Undergraduate Admissions in advance of your Bear Facts session dates. Also, remember to bring unofficial copies of your scores and transcripts with you to Bear Facts to show to your academic advisor.
Undergraduate Admissions
3106 Student Services Building
Riverside, CA. 92521
  • Alarm clock
  • Casual comfortable clothes and walking shoes (our program involves substantial walking)
  • Change of clothes
  • Personal toiletries, bathrobe, shower footwear (there are shared bathrooms on each residence hall floor)
  • Notepad and pen or pencil
  • The Orientation brochure and any other UCR materials you may have questions about
  • A water bottle (filled with water or your favorite sports drink)
  • Spending money (you may have the opportunity to visit the Campus Store where UCR clothing and memorabilia are available for purchase (this is also where' you'll buy textbooks later on, but you won't need to worry about that yet); the Convenience Store in Pentland Hills will be open at night for snack purchases).
